An excerpt from Part 2 of The Odyssey that establishes Odysseus' weakness is when he reveals his identity to the Cyclops, Polyphemus. This decision leads to a series of events that ultimately put Odysseus and his men in danger, showcasing his flaw of hubris or excessive pride.

What is the event what is happening of the Cyclopes excerpt from the epic poem The Odyssey?

In the Cyclopes excerpt from The Odyssey, Odysseus and his men are trapped in the cave of Polyphemus, a Cyclops. Polyphemus eats some of Odysseus's men and then blocks the entrance of the cave with a huge boulder to prevent their escape. Odysseus then comes up with a plan to blind Polyphemus and escape the cave.

How does this excerpt prove that Odysseus and men caused their own problems?

The excerpt shows that Odysseus and his men were warned not to harm the cattle of Helios, but they chose to disregard the warning and slaughtered the cattle, leading to their own downfall. This decision to act against the gods' command ultimately caused their ship to be destroyed in a violent storm, showing that their actions directly led to their problems.
